Once power is restored and stable, the unit will revert to on-line power and begin to rechange its' internal battery. It will drain its' internal battery pretty quickly if external power does not return fairly quickly (3 to 10 minutes or so, depending on your load draw).

Sorry, there was a problem. Please try again later.The UPS will revert back to line mode from battery mode whenever wall power returns and meets the UPS's requirements for input power.
